Ave maria grotto

The Ave Maria Grotto is an interesting attraction to say the least.  It is home to 125 miniatures of other famous structures from around the world.  Since 1934, people have been coming from all around the world to see this interesting site.  It was created by a bavarian benedictine monk named Joseph Zoetl.   Brother Joseph created all but 6 of his magnificent structures from photos and images.  It spans close to 4 acres and is located on the grounds of St. Bernard’s Abbey.  I would definitely not miss a chance to see this attraction if you are in the nearby area.

 

Sportsman Lake Park

When you visit Cullman, one of the funnest places to go with the family is Sportsman Lake Park.  This park is home to almost 5 miles of hiking trails.  It also has ameities for camping and swimming.  In case you don’t really like the water, there are plenty of other things you can do.  That is because the park also has Putt-Putt golf, a playground, hiking trails, picnic areas, pavilions, paddle boats, a train and a Ferris wheel.  Basically this is a place to go for outdoor fun for the whole family.

Clarkson Covered Bridge

This has positively got to be one of the best spots to visit in Cullman, hands down.   The Clarkson Covered Bridge was built in 1904 over Crooked Creek.  It was built on the property of a mail carrier for the price of $1500. 

Originally, It was called the Legg Covered Bridge because that was the name of the mail carrier who owned the property.   Legg saw the need for improved roadways in the area and as such, donated most of the materials to build the bridge.   

In 1921 the bridge was almost completely destroyed by floods. The majority of the pieces were found downstream, and the following year, the bridge was rebuilt. Rebuilding the bridge cost another $1500.  The bridge was in service until 1962. After that, a nearby concrete bridge rendered it obsolete. 

In 1975, the bridge was restored as part of the bicentennial project. at the same time, a grist mill and a log cabin were also restored.  Today, the bridge is a popular attraction for tourists and is also a popular wedding venue.
